How To Fix EE_AMI048 - Operational state already requested for all devices


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: EE_AMI - Message Class for AMI Applications

  • Message number: 048

  • Message text: Operational state already requested for all devices

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message EE_AMI048 - Operational state already requested for all devices ?

    The SAP error message EE_AMI048: Operational state already requested for all devices typically occurs in the context of the SAP AMI (Advanced Metering Infrastructure) solution, particularly when dealing with device management and operational state changes.

    Cause:

    This error message indicates that a request to change the operational state of devices has already been made, and the system is attempting to process the same request again. This can happen due to:

    1. Duplicate Requests: The same operational state change request is being sent multiple times for the same devices.
    2. Timing Issues: The system may not have completed processing the previous request, leading to a situation where a new request is made before the first one is finalized.
    3. System Configuration: There may be issues with the configuration of the device management system or the way requests are being handled.

    Solution:

    To resolve the EE_AMI048 error, consider the following steps:

    1. Check Request Logs: Review the logs to identify if the operational state change request was already processed. This can help confirm if the request is indeed a duplicate.

    2. Wait for Processing: If the system is still processing the previous request, wait for it to complete before sending a new request.

    3. Avoid Duplicate Requests: Ensure that your application or process does not send duplicate requests. Implement checks to prevent resending the same operational state change.

    4.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ings in the SAP AMI system to ensure that they are set up correctly and that there are no issues with how operational states are managed.

    5. Error Handling: Implement error handling in your application to gracefully manage situations where a request cannot be processed due to the operational state already being requested.
